In his office Donny Donnelly, wearing only a thong, was lying on his sunbed topping up his tan. Prominent on the wall of the office that faced the door were two large framed photographs, a spotlight playing on each of them, so that any visitor to Donny's inner sanctum could not possibly miss them. One of the photographs was of Ron Atkinson, who was Donny's hero. The other was of Ron and Donny together, Ron with a friendly arm around Donny's shoulder. It was signed, 'To my mate Donny, Big Ron.' Money could not have bought it. Apart from their respective heights, Ron being about six two and Donny being nearer five two, they were quite similar, both in build and features. Both of them had pudgy bodies and fat faces sporting a Mediterranean tan, and both had blonde hair worn combed over the top of their head in the manner favoured by Bobby Charlton when he had some to favour. However if one were to look closely at the photo one would see that while Ron was naturally blonde Donny was blonde courtesy of a bottle of peroxide, his black roots giving him away. Furthermore Donny had plenty of hair and, unlike Ron, didn't really need to comb it over the top of his head in a vain attempt to camouflage a balding pate.
    His thirty minutes up, Donny swung his legs off the sunbed, got to his feet, and went to the mirror to check his tan. It was just right, midway between light and George Hamilton. Pleased, he went to the window to check on his squad. As he looked out at them one of the players, Higgs, a man short in stature and even shorter in talent, was about to take a throw in near the corner flag, and about ten players were jockeying for position in the penalty area. Donny nodded with approval. He had recently spent a lot of time coaching Higgs in the art of the long throw-in and now the player was putting his newly aquired skill into practise.
    Higgs threw the ball in. Its trajectory was all wrong, much too high, and the ball landed well short of the jostling players. Donny groaned, opened the window and shouted out. "Higgsy"!
    Higgs looked over to the portakabin. "Boss?"
    "Arch your back more." Donny demonstrated the required technique, bending backwards from the hips. "To give yourself more leverage."
